Operations of the Narcotics Law Enforcement Agency (Ndlea), have arrested a drug ruler sought, Okpara Paul Chigozie, who has been running for seven years.
Director, Media & Advocacy Ndlea, Femi Babafemi, who revealed this in a statement in Abuja on Sunday, said the 60 -year -old drug kingpin was arrested while trying to send cocaine and metamfetamine 11 kg to the southeast and other parts of the country.
In the statement, Babafemi said OKPARA, who had been on the desired list of the agency since 2019, was arrested at his hiding place in 72 Micheal Ojo Street, Isheri in the Ojo area in the state of Lagos on Sunday, July 13, after the prevention of several delivery in Ilasamja throughout-Expressway.
“In the morning operation, the team of Ndlea officers who acted based on credible intelligence, arrested one of Okpara’s couriers, Achebe Kenneth Nnamdi, who was 51 years old when heading to Onitsha, the state of Anambra with a white Toyota Sienna vehicle,” said the agency spokesman.
“The agency’s sniffer dog was then taken to search for vehicles after that 7.6 kilograms of cocaine and 900 grams of metamfetamine were found to be hidden in the body of the space bus body.

“Follow -up operations were immediately carried out at the Okpara hiding place in Isheri where an additional 1.8kg cocaine and 1.3kg metamfetamine were found from his residence,” he said.
Also talking about other arrests made by Ndlea operators, Babafemi said a passenger bound by Italy, Omoregie Nice Uyiosa, was arrested on Wednesday 16 July, while boarding a plane to Italy through Istanbul with Turki Airlines flights.
‘At Murtala Muhammated International Airport (MMIA) Ikeja Lagos, Ndlea operator in an operation together with flight security personnel from the Federal Nigeria Airport Authority (FAAN) on Wednesday, July 16, restored 7,790 Tramadol and Rohypnol pills from Omi-Bound Passenger swamps, Omi.
“The suspect who will go to Italy through Istanbul on a Turkish Airlines flight claims he buys the drug himself, hoping to sell it in Italy at a higher price.”
